These three separate collections of poems–Conley Bottom: A Poemoir, Mill Springs, and Monticello–form a triadic reflection of events that highlight a relationship with South Central Kentucky.
Down Along Highway 90 goes back to Wayne County to gather the meaning of growing up in a transformative time when no one expected anyone to transform. In Conley Bottom: A Poemoir, the reader is taken back on excursions to Lake Cumberland where locals gathered with styrofoam coolers and blow-up floatables to escape the summer heat, (but couldn' t escape Ohio vacationers!).
Mill Springs examines the historical events of a place and links the residual impacts of the past to a present family's lives–as the future waits. And Monticello captures the progression of a town that never expected to grow, change, or lose its identity even though every town knows better. These three collected collections take the reader on a trip through history, meaning, and insights into what it meant to grow up Down Along Highway 90.
